Men's Tops

Update your wardrobe essentials with our premium t-shirts and tops for men. Available in a variety of solid and striped patterns along with heritage inspired prints, discover Barbour t-shirts, polo shirts, long and short sleeve shirts, graphic tees and so much more. A quality top is the perfect foundation for any outfit and we have men's top to suit all styles and tastes. Shop all men's tops, t-shirts and more online at Barbour.

Show Filters

73 Items

View

Page
Set Descending Direction
  1. Lomond Tailored Fit Shirt Lomond Tailored Fit Shirt
    Barbour

    Lomond Tailored Fit Shirt

    From $110.00
    + More Colours
  2. Glendale Overshirt Glendale Overshirt
    Barbour

    Glendale Overshirt

    From $180.00
    + More Colours
  3. Portwell Regular Shirt Portwell Regular Shirt
    Barbour

    Portwell Regular Shirt

    From $110.00
    + More Colours
  4. Linton Tailored Linen Shirt Linton Tailored Linen Shirt
    Barbour

    Linton Tailored Linen Shirt

    From $110.00
    + More Colours
  5. Powburn Polo Shirt Powburn Polo Shirt
    Barbour

    Powburn Polo Shirt

    From $100.00
    + More Colours
  6. Gordon Short-Sleeved Tailored Shirt Gordon Short-Sleeved Tailored Shirt
    Barbour

    Gordon Short-Sleeved Tailored Shirt

    From $90.00
    + More Colours
  7. Douglas Short-Sleeved Tailored Shirt Douglas Short-Sleeved Tailored Shirt
    Barbour

    Douglas Short-Sleeved Tailored Shirt

    From $100.00
    + More Colours
  8. Harris Tailored Shirt Harris Tailored Shirt
    Barbour

    Harris Tailored Shirt

    From $110.00
    + More Colours
  9. Nelson Tailored Shirt Nelson Tailored Shirt
    Barbour

    Nelson Tailored Shirt

    From $100.00
    + More Colours
  10. Kinson Tailored Shirt Kinson Tailored Shirt
    Barbour

    Kinson Tailored Shirt

    From $95.00
    + More Colours
  11. Nelson Short Sleeve Summer Shirt Nelson Short Sleeve Summer Shirt
    Barbour

    Nelson Short Sleeve Summer Shirt

    From $95.00
    + More Colours
  12. Nelson Short Sleeve Summer Shirt Nelson Short Sleeve Summer Shirt
    Barbour

    Nelson Short Sleeve Summer Shirt

    From $95.00
    + More Colours
  13. Swaledale Regular Shirt Swaledale Regular Shirt
    Barbour

    Swaledale Regular Shirt

    From $110.00
    + More Colours
  14. Somerby Striped Tailored Shirt Somerby Striped Tailored Shirt
    Barbour

    Somerby Striped Tailored Shirt

    From $110.00
    + More Colours
  15. Glendale Overshirt Glendale Overshirt
    Barbour

    Glendale Overshirt

    From $180.00
    + More Colours
  16. Faulkner Overshirt Faulkner Overshirt
    Barbour

    Faulkner Overshirt

    From $230.00
    + More Colours
  17. Lannich Overshirt Lannich Overshirt
    Barbour

    Lannich Overshirt

    From $160.00
    + More Colours
  18. Casswell Overshirt Casswell Overshirt
    Barbour

    Casswell Overshirt

    From $180.00
    + More Colours
  19. Lyle Tailored Shirt Lyle Tailored Shirt
    Barbour

    Lyle Tailored Shirt

    From $120.00
    + More Colours
  20. Cramlington Polo Shirt Cramlington Polo Shirt
    Barbour

    Cramlington Polo Shirt

    From $125.00
    + More Colours
  21. Cramlington Polo Shirt Cramlington Polo Shirt
    Barbour

    Cramlington Polo Shirt

    From $125.00
    + More Colours
  22. Dartmouth Tailored Shirt Dartmouth Tailored Shirt
    Barbour

    Dartmouth Tailored Shirt

    From $110.00
    + More Colours
  23. Harthorpe Tailored Shirt Harthorpe Tailored Shirt
    Barbour

    Harthorpe Tailored Shirt

    From $100.00
    + More Colours
  24. Dunoon Tailored Shirt Dunoon Tailored Shirt
    Barbour

    Dunoon Tailored Shirt

    From $110.00
    + More Colours

Show Filters

73 Items

View

Page
Set Descending Direction